'New Amsterdam' Season 2 Episode 2: Can Max bounce back after the biggest loss of his life?

Max definitely needs help to get through his hellish period in his life, but he is not ready to ask for it yet.

Season 2 Episode 1 of 'New Amsterdam' which premiered Tuesday, September 24 night, revealed that Georgia (Lisa O'Hare) is no longer a part of the story and while this is great news for fans of Helen (Freeman Agyeman) and Lauren (Janet Montgomery), it is the greatest loss in Max's (Ryan Eggold) life. We saw in the previous episode how he is still more or less living in denial, and immersing himself in his late wife's memories. 

Max is now a single dad and thanks to the new cancer treatment, he is strong and healthy enough to run the hospital as he did before chemotherapy started. However, he is extremely broken inside and is struggling to look Helen and Lauren in the face, because he is reminded of his wife who died in the accident whereas these two got to live. He even walked past Helen without giving her so much as a hug when she got back to the hospital after the three-month recovery break. 

Lauren seems to be burdened with her own issues, potentially survivors guilt coupled with the fact that she doesn't trust herself to take painkillers despite the immense pain she is in. She is sober now, and she would not want to risk taking any pills even if it means she has a tough time getting through the day. Thankfully, she has Helen by her side, promising to sit by her side and hold her hand through everything. 

 

Helen also wants to be there for Max, but he is refusing to let her in. We also saw her make a huge sacrifice for her sake in the previous episode - share her department with Max's new oncologist whom she has a past with. When Max comes to know of it, he will certainly reverse whatever deal they have, but the way he is ignoring her, it remains to be seen whether he will even come to know of it anytime soon. 

Max definitely needs help, but he is not ready to ask for it yet. Watch Season 2 Episode 2 of 'New Amsterdam' which will air Tuesday, October 1, to see how Max is going to get through this hellish period in his life.
